Portugal ended the month of July with 320,000 people unemployed, with the unemployment rate remaining at 5.7%, the same value recorded in June. The National Statistics Institute is the entity responsible for releasing this data on the Portuguese labour market. When compared to the same period last year, the unemployment rate shows a slight decrease, indicating marginal improvement compared to July 2023. This monthly stability comes in a context where the Portuguese labour market has been showing signs of resilience, although the absolute number of unemployed people remains high.
